Job Title: Doctor of Physical Therapy ( DPT ) – TBI & Spinal Cord Injury Rehabilitation Job Summary: We are seeking a compassionate and skilled Doctor of Physical Therapy ( DPT ) to join our neurorehabilitation team, specializing in the treatment of patients recovering from traumatic brain injury (TBI) and spinal cord injury (SCI). The ideal candidate will bring clinical expertise, critical thinking, and a patient-centered approach to help individuals maximize functional independence and quality of life. Key Responsibilities: • Perform comprehensive neuromuscular and functional evaluations for patients with TBI and SCI. • Develop and implement individualized, evidence-based treatment plans focusing on mobility, balance, strength, coordination, and neuroplasticity. • Provide skilled interventions including gait training, wheelchair mobility training, neuro-reeducation, spasticity management, and assistive device training. • Educate patients, families, and caregivers on recovery expectations, home exercises, and adaptive strategies. • Collaborate with an interdisciplinary team including physicians, occupational therapists, speech therapists, neuropsychologists, and nursing staff. • Monitor progress toward goals, modify plans as needed, and document outcomes clearly and accurately. • Maintain knowledge of emerging neurorehabilitation technologies and best practices. Qualifications: • Doctor of Physical Therapy ( DPT ) from an accredited program. • Current state licensure or eligibility for licensure. • Minimum of 1–2 years of experience in neurorehabilitation or a strong clinical interest in TBI/SCI populations. • Strong understanding of neurologic recovery principles and functional outcome measures. • Excellent communication, empathy, and problem-solving skills. • Certification in Neuro-Developmental Treatment (NDT), Neuro-IFRAH, or similar preferred (not required). Work Environment: • Inpatient or outpatient rehabilitation facility with a focus on neurologic care. • May involve use of specialized equipment such as body-weight supported treadmills, FES, robotic gait trainers, or virtual reality-based therapy tools. • Physically demanding role that includes patient transfers, ambulation support, and use of adaptive equipment.

Definition: Under the supervision of a Registered Physical Therapist, provides direct patient care using physical therapy modalities and procedures in accordance with orders from the patient's physician. Distinguishing Characteristics: The classification of Physical Therapy Assistant is licensed by the State of California and provides direct patient care activities under the direction and supervision of a Registered Physical Therapist. Physical Therapy Assistant is distinguished from the classification of Physical Therapist by the latter's responsibility to independently evaluate, plan and implement physical rehabilitation treatment programs requested by a physician and from the Physical Therapy Aide by the latter's limitations regarding the provision of direct patient care activities. Essential Functions: Performs a program of corrective exercise and treatment for assigned patients under the direction of a Physical Therapist who has assessed and evaluated the patient. Monitors patients performing therapeutic exercise; Administers treatments such as exercise, gait training, massage, whirlpool, hot packs, diathermy, ultrasound, paraffin, ice packs and traction under supervision of the Physical Therapist; Observes patients undergoing treatment and reports unusual occurrences and physical condition of the patients to the Physical Therapist; Maintains appropriate communication with supervisor, physical therapy staff, patients and other hospital personnel; Follows appropriate documentation procedures and established guidelines to record information and maintain records of services provided; Participates in professional development through continuing education and in service training; monitors quality management issues; Maintains treatment areas and equipment in proper working order; Dependent upon area of practice or department assignments, demonstrates clinical knowledge and skill in the care of the newborn, infant, toddler, child, adolescent, adult and geriatric patient ranging up to 100+ years of age.
